Nova turma com conversação 5x por semana 🔥

Nova turma com conversação 5x por semana 🔥

Os Fundamentos Para Se Tornar Um Desenvolvedor Front-End Júnior

HTML: A Base do Desenvolvimento Web

HTML (Hypertext Markup Language) é uma das bases fundamentais do desenvolvimento web. É uma linguagem de marcação que permite estruturar e organizar o conteúdo de uma página da web. Como desenvolvedor front-end júnior, é essencial entender a estrutura básica do HTML, os diferentes elementos e tags disponíveis, bem como a semântica por trás delas. Além disso, é importante estar atualizado com as últimas versões do HTML, como o HTML5, e suas novas funcionalidades.

CSS: Controle de Aparência e Layout

CSS (Cascading Style Sheets) é outra peça fundamental do desenvolvimento front-end. É uma linguagem de estilos que permite controlar a aparência e o layout de uma página da web. Para se tornar um desenvolvedor front-end júnior, é crucial aprender os conceitos básicos do CSS, como seletores, propriedades e valores. Além disso, é importante compreender como utilizar o CSS para criar layouts responsivos e adaptáveis a diferentes dispositivos e tamanhos de tela.

JavaScript: Adicionando Interatividade

JavaScript é uma linguagem de programação que adiciona interatividade e dinamismo a uma página da web. Como desenvolvedor front-end júnior, é fundamental ter conhecimento básico de JavaScript para manipular elementos da página, trabalhar com eventos e realizar validações de formulários. Além disso, é importante compreender os conceitos de programação, como variáveis, condicionais, loops e funções, para escrever scripts eficientes e reutilizáveis.

Habilidades Essenciais Além dos Fundamentos Técnicos

Além dos fundamentos técnicos, existem outras habilidades essenciais que podem impulsionar sua carreira como desenvolvedor front-end júnior. Uma delas é a capacidade de resolver problemas de forma lógica e eficiente. O desenvolvimento web envolve constantemente a resolução de desafios e bugs, por isso é importante ter habilidades de resolução de problemas e depuração.

Outra habilidade importante é a capacidade de trabalhar em equipe. O desenvolvimento web muitas vezes envolve colaboração com designers, desenvolvedores back-end e outros profissionais. Ser capaz de se comunicar e colaborar efetivamente com os membros da equipe é essencial para o sucesso do projeto.

Além disso, é importante manter-se atualizado com as tendências e avanços na área de desenvolvimento front-end. A tecnologia está em constante evolução, e é fundamental estar atualizado com as novas ferramentas, frameworks e práticas recomendadas. Participar de comunidades online, conferências e cursos de atualização é uma ótima maneira de se manter informado e aprimorar suas habilidades.

O Caminho a Seguir: Guia Completo Para Se Tornar Um Desenvolvedor Front-End Júnior

Agora que você entende os fundamentos e as habilidades essenciais para se tornar um desenvolvedor front-end júnior, vamos explorar o caminho a seguir para iniciar sua carreira na área de tecnologia. Este guia completo fornecerá dicas, recursos e conselhos práticos para ajudá-lo a dar os primeiros passos nessa jornada emocionante.

  1. Adquira conhecimento teórico: Comece estudando os conceitos teóricos do desenvolvimento front-end. Existem muitos recursos online gratuitos, como tutoriais em vídeo, documentações e blogs especializados, que podem ajudá-lo a aprender os fundamentos.
  2. Pratique com projetos pessoais: A prática é fundamental para o desenvolvimento de suas habilidades. Comece a criar projetos pessoais, como websites simples, para aplicar o que você aprendeu. Isso também ajudará a construir um portfólio para mostrar aos potenciais empregadores.
  3. Faça cursos e workshops: Participar de cursos e workshops específicos de desenvolvimento front-end pode fornecer conhecimentos mais aprofundados e práticos. Procure por cursos online ou presenciais que sejam relevantes para as tecnologias e ferramentas que você deseja dominar.
  4. Construa uma presença online: Crie um perfil profissional em plataformas como o LinkedIn e GitHub para mostrar suas habilidades e projetos. Compartilhe seu conhecimento através de um blog ou redes sociais, participando de discussões e contribuindo para a comunidade de desenvolvedores.
  5. Faça estágios ou trabalhos voluntários: Considere a possibilidade de realizar estágios ou trabalhos voluntários para ganhar experiência prática na área. Isso também pode ajudá-lo a estabelecer contatos profissionais e construir um network sólido.
  6. Participe de comunidades e eventos: Engajar-se com a comunidade de desenvolvedores é uma ótima maneira de aprender e se conectar com outras pessoas que compartilham seus interesses. Participe de grupos locais, conferências e eventos relacionados ao desenvolvimento front-end.
  7. Esteja aberto a oportunidades: No início da carreira, pode ser necessário aceitar oportunidades de trabalho que não sejam exatamente o que você deseja, mas que ofereçam a chance de ganhar experiência e aprender com profissionais mais experientes. Esteja aberto a essas oportunidades e aproveite ao máximo cada experiência.

Dicas e Recursos Para Iniciar Sua Carreira na Área de Tecnologia como Desenvolvedor Front-End Júnior

Aqui estão algumas dicas e recursos adicionais para ajudá-lo a iniciar sua carreira na área de tecnologia como desenvolvedor front-end júnior. Essas informações complementam o guia completo fornecido anteriormente e podem ser úteis em sua jornada.

  1. Faça cursos online: Existem muitos cursos online gratuitos e pagos que podem ajudá-lo a aprender e aprimorar suas habilidades como desenvolvedor front-end júnior. Sites como Udemy, Coursera e Codecademy oferecem uma variedade de cursos abrangendo diferentes aspectos do desenvolvimento front-end.
  2. Participe de comunidades online: Junte-se a fóruns, grupos de discussão e comunidades online de desenvolvedores front-end. Esses espaços são ótimos para fazer perguntas, obter conselhos, compartilhar conhecimento e se conectar com outros profissionais.
  3. Leia blogs e artigos especializados: Mantenha-se atualizado com as últimas notícias e tendências no campo do desenvolvimento front-end, lendo blogs e artigos de especialistas. Isso o ajudará a expandir seu conhecimento e a descobrir novas ferramentas e técnicas.
  4. Pratique resolvendo problemas reais: Desafie-se a resolver problemas reais de desenvolvimento front-end. Isso pode ser feito através de desafios de programação, exercícios de codificação ou até mesmo contribuindo para projetos de código aberto. Essas práticas ajudarão a desenvolver suas habilidades de resolução de problemas e a ganhar confiança em suas capacidades.
  5. Esteja aberto a aprender constantemente: A área de tecnologia está em constante evolução, e é importante estar disposto a aprender e se adaptar. Esteja aberto a novas tecnologias, frameworks e melhores práticas, e esteja disposto a sair da sua zona de conforto para expandir seus conhecimentos.
  6. Busque mentores: Encontrar um mentor na área de desenvolvimento front-end pode ser extremamente valioso. Um mentor pode orientá-lo, fornecer conselhos e compartilhar sua experiência para ajudá-lo a crescer profissionalmente.
  7. Prepare-se para entrevistas: À medida que você começa a buscar oportunidades de trabalho como desenvolvedor front-end júnior, é importante se preparar para entrevistas. Pratique perguntas comuns de entrevistas técnicas, revise seus projetos e esteja preparado para demonstrar suas habilidades durante o processo de seleção.

Iniciar uma carreira como desenvolvedor front-end júnior pode ser uma jornada emocionante e gratificante. Seguindo os fundamentos, adquirindo habilidades essenciais, explorando recursos e dicas, você estará bem encaminhado para alcançar seus objetivos na área de tecnologia. Lembre-se de sempre se manter atualizado, praticar continuamente e aproveitar as oportunidades para aprender e crescer. Boa sorte em sua jornada como desenvolvedor front-end júnior!

A Awari é a melhor plataforma para aprender sobre programação no Brasil.

Aqui você encontra cursos com aulas ao vivo, mentorias individuais com os melhores profissionais do mercado e suporte de carreira personalizado para dar seu próximo passo profissional e aprender habilidades como Data Science, Data Analytics, Machine Learning e mais.

Já pensou em aprender de maneira individualizada com profissionais que atuam em empresas como Nubank, Amazon e Google? Clique aqui para se inscrever na Awari e começar a construir agora mesmo o próximo capítulo da sua carreira em dados.

🔥 Intensivão de inglês na Fluency!

Nome*
Ex.: João Santos
E-mail*
Ex.: email@dominio.com
Telefone*
somente números

Próximos conteúdos

🔥 Intensivão de inglês na Fluency!

Nome*
Ex.: João Santos
E-mail*
Ex.: email@dominio.com
Telefone*
somente números

🔥 Intensivão de inglês na Fluency!

Nome*
Ex.: João Santos
E-mail*
Ex.: email@dominio.com
Telefone*
somente números

🔥 Intensivão de inglês na Fluency!

Nome*
Ex.: João Santos
E-mail*
Ex.: email@dominio.com
Telefone*
somente números
inscreva-se

Entre para a próxima turma com bônus exclusivos

Faça parte da maior escola de idiomas do mundo com os professores mais amados da internet.

Curso completo do básico ao avançado
Aplicativo de memorização para lembrar de tudo que aprendeu
Aulas de conversação para destravar um novo idioma
Certificado reconhecido no mercado
Nome*
Ex.: João Santos
E-mail*
Ex.: email@dominio.com
Telefone*
somente números
Empresa
Ex.: Fluency Academy
Ao clicar no botão “Solicitar Proposta”, você concorda com os nossos Termos de Uso e Política de Privacidade.